Ala.Code 1975, 15-8-1, provides in pertinent part, "An indictment is an accusation in writing presented by the grand jury of the county, charging a person with an indictable offense." Hours after Meade's indictment, a federal civil rights lawsuit was filed on behalf of Goodson's estate by his family in U.S. District Court in Columbus.
